Output 41ab318ecf7481eea9a68023eaec906e4fb4d37408f8007805163974e4da26c2:0

value
26565085
script pubkey
OP_0 OP_PUSHBYTES_20 123df5011e5b84b747eb69f24502e5ab0ad016bc
address
bc1qzg7l2qg7twztw3ltd8ey2qh94v9dq94u8xsgfx
transaction
41ab318ecf7481eea9a68023eaec906e4fb4d37408f8007805163974e4da26c2
spent
true